      Re: Prototype vs. Infamous

      The skills remain generally the same. Just the effect of them are different.

      I.E., the lightning grenades. As Hero, the explosions are more powerful but are more concentrated, so as not to catch as many innocents in the blast. As Infamous, the grenade explosions are weaker, but the blast radius is slightly larger and lets off smaller explosions around the area that'll be more destructive to both your enemies and innocents.

      Keep in mind Cole's not really completely evil. As Infamous, you're still trying to save the day...you just care less about those harmed along the way.

                              Re: Prototype vs. Infamous

                              Oh that final Thunder ability is just fun. I can't wait to try that as a villain, standing up on top of a tall building with a generator or two and just rain hell on everyone down below. But yea, the counter surveillance quests were just annoying, easily the worst type of quests.

                              I was also impressed by how many ways you could use your electricity to recharge yourself. Like after you drained a generator or lamp post empty, you could zap it a few times to charge it up again so you could drain more energy for it. You could even zap fences or other metal structures and drain the energy from that. It was the little things like that, or killing people by standing in a puddle with them, that make this game great.
